📝 Overview

We’re looking for an SMB Customer Success Manager to join our Sydney team and help drive customer activation, retention, and growth across a portfolio of customers across the built world industries. You’ll be the trusted day-to-day partner for customers after they’ve signed, guiding them through onboarding, ensuring they’re getting value quickly, and helping them embed Sitemate’s products into real-world workflows.

This role is ideal for someone early in their tech career who enjoys working with people, solving problems, and learning fast. You’ll collaborate closely with Sales, Account Management, Support, and Product to remove blockers, improve customer outcomes, and share feedback that shapes what we build next.

Success in this role looks like: healthy accounts, strong adoption, happy customers, and clear action plans for improving usage and reducing churn risk.

đź”§ Day-to-Day

  • Own a portfolio of SMB customers as their main point of contact post-sale, building strong relationships and trust.

  • Run onboarding and activation: Set success plans, configure accounts, train users, and guide customers to their first wins quickly.

  • Prescribe best-practice workflows: Recommend how to configure Sitemate for different operational use cases across heavy industries.

  • Drive adoption through proactive check-ins, enablement, and ongoing education (calls, emails, Looms, and in-app guidance where relevant).

  • Monitor account health: Track usage signals, sentiment, and risks, then take action early to prevent churn.

  • Identify growth opportunities (where appropriate): Look for expansion signals, additional teams/sites, and new use cases, then send them through to the Account Management team to action them.

  • Be the internal voice of the customer: Share product feedback, recurring pain points, and what’s working well to inform priorities and improvements.

  • Stay organised: Send recap emails after ever meeting, set follow up tasks in Salesforce, and book in follow-ups to operate with clarity and consistency.

⚡ Challenges

  • Balancing a portfolio across the journey: You’ll have customers at different stages (new onboarding, configuring account, started usage, activated, at risk, etc), so prioritisation is key.

  • Pace and learning curve: We move quickly and expect high ownership. The first few months involve a lot of product, process, and industry context, this environment suits someone who likes learning fast.

  • Complex, practical environments: Our customers operate in heavy industries with real constraints (sites, crews, shifting priorities). You’ll need to be pragmatic and outcome-focused.

  • Tough conversations: You’ll sometimes need to address low engagement, push for action, or reset expectations, professionally and confidently.

  • Strong operating standards: We have clear SOPs and ways of working. If you’re used to “making it up as you go,” you may need to unlearn some habits and lean into the engineered structure.
